Transaction 5759c738d5988310e30e3985926a0a454a4b2619e98e1afde917d4740baa03e0

1 Input
2 Outputs
  • 5759c738d5988310e30e3985926a0a454a4b2619e98e1afde917d4740baa03e0:0
  • value  29913
    address  125gS7rKcFR2NxD4CscR7htVAhF7z976io
  • 5759c738d5988310e30e3985926a0a454a4b2619e98e1afde917d4740baa03e0:1
  • value  608137
    address  3KFNa3DePk5tWk4Ejnj5XcdB6gDZATztdP